Description

I am having issues with the authentication step. Instead of generating a code, I get the invalid request displayed above.

What I Did

I have ran:

ee_Intialize(quiet = TRUE)
ee_Authenticate(quiet = TRUE)

ee_Intialize(quiet = FALSE)
ee_Authenticate(quiet = FALSE)

ee_Authenticate(auth_mode = "paste")
ee_Authenticate(auth_mode = "notebook")
ee_Authenticate(auth_mode = "gcloud")
ee_Authenticate(auth_mode = "appdefault")

Each time I run into the invalid request in some form or another.

Any tips for getting around the authentication step would be greatly appreciated!

fpirotti commented 3 weeks ago

Run this to authenticae reticulate::py_run_string("import ee; ee.Authenticate()") Run this to initialize... now GEE wants projects so you have to define a project - make sure you upgrade to latest GEE API (earthengine-api 0.1.416 ) - projects can be a number or ID (e.g. user/XXXX/projectname) reticulate::py_run_string("import ee; ee.Initialize(project='309736351492')")

hope it helps
